Description

This is a milepost from the early 19th century, made of cast iron. It has a triangular shape with the upper part cut away in a concave curve. The milepost is inscribed with the following distances: CASTLETON 6 MILES, CHAPEL EN LE FRITH 5 MILES, SHEFFIELD 16 MILES, and HATHERSAGE 6 MILES.
